Output 68d16b873283702bd04a0a239a616df80345103a4d1c0623be29b271efab7ecb:0

value
522100
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d2d41c8a1ac62c0a6a1be84328a5ea16e5861ecc OP_EQUALVERIFY OP_CHECKSIG
address
1LDm13pKYvi1hdyFjSuzkUVWHRKzQQYqcg
transaction
68d16b873283702bd04a0a239a616df80345103a4d1c0623be29b271efab7ecb
confirmations
257178
spent
true